Battery temperature detecting device for a charger

    Abstract: A battery temperature detecting device adapted particularly for a charger can monitor the variation of temperature of a charged battery and the detected is transmitted immediatedly to an internal circuit of the charger. The present detecting device is equipped with a shell, a heat sensitive sensor disposed is the shell and coupled to the internal circuit of the charger, and a fixing member which can firmly attach the detecting device to the surface of a charged battery whereby the heat sensitive sensor can pick up the variation of temperature of the battery and the same is delivered by wire to the internal circuit of the charger.

    Abstract: A protective cover support rack for electronic devices includes at least a protective cover body, a support lid and a hinge assembly. The protective cover body has an inner rim with an annular U-shaped trough formed thereon to hold and encase the body of an electronic device, and a lower half portion to cover the back side of the electronic device. The hinge assembly includes two hinge means each has one end fastened to one lateral side of the protective cover body and another end fastened to the bottom side of the support lid. Thereby the support lid can be adjusted at an angle smaller than 360 degrees to allow users to swivel to the front side as required to protect the screen of the electronic device, or adjust to a standing position to facilitate viewing, or fold it to fully in contact with back side of the protective cover body at a storing position, or swivel to facilitate hand grasping in use, thus provide diversified usages and improve practicality.

    Abstract: A touch control click structure includes at least an action board swayable up and down, a click switch and a touch panel. The action board has an axle mechanism at one end that is fastened to a chassis in an integrated manner, an extension zone in a middle portion and a click zone at another end that is swayable. The click switch aims to control input movements and is located below the action board. The touch panel is located above the click zone. The extension zone is formed at a desired length such that any position of the click zone can get a depressing pressure approximate to each other when depressed. Therefore the click zone can be swayed steadily up and down. The touch panel also provides position detecting function such that different output signals are generated when different positions are depressed

    Abstract: A method for aiding control of cursor movement through a trackpad includes a step of detecting finger touch conditions on the trackpad to control operation modes for cursor movement on a screen. The finger touch conditions are set at least in a first condition and a second condition. In the first condition the trackpad is touched by one finger, and the cursor movement on the screen is controlled in a relative movement operation mode. It the second condition the trackpad is touched in fashions other than the first condition (such as touching the trackpad with two fingers or depressing the trackpad with a selected force), and the cursor movement on the screen is controlled in an automatic movement operation mode. Through the method of the invention the cursor on the screen can be quickly moved to a targeted position without overtaxing user's fingers.
